One example of an agent of physical weathering in a rock is ice. When water seeps into cracks in a rock and then freezes, it expands, causing the rock to break apart. Over time, repeated freezing and thawing can lead to the release of rock fragments through a process known as frost wedging.

The agent that causes frost wedging is water. Water enters cracks in rocks, freezes, and expands, exerting pressure on the rock and causing it to break apart. This process is enhanced in areas with fluctuating temperatures and frequent freeze-thaw cycles.
